The Catholic churches in Washington D.C., District of Columbia, represent a significant and historic part of the city's religious and architectural landscape. Characterized by their adherence to the teachings of the Roman Catholic Church, these parishes operate under the Archdiocese of Washington and serve as centers for worship, community, and sacramental life, including the celebration of Mass and other liturgical traditions. According to available directory data, there are 8 registered Catholic churches within the district's boundaries. These institutions range from grand, historic cathedrals to local neighborhood parishes, many of which are notable for their cultural heritage and community outreach programs. Their presence contributes to the diverse spiritual fabric of the nation's capital.
